Gant Bridge is an iconic landmark of [[San Fierro]], [[State of San Andreas|San Andreas]], connecting [[Juniper Hollow]] and [[Palisades]] in San Fierro to [[Tierra Robada]] and [[Bayside]]. Spanning [[San Fierro Bay]], the bridge also serves as the eastern gateway to the waterways which divide San Andreas state.

The bridge is clearly modeled after the [[wp:Golden Gate Bridge|Golden Gate Bridge]] in San Francisco, but is shorter and tends to be bathed only in low morning fog. Like the Golden Gate Bridge, Gant Bridge is a suspension bridge supported by two pillars and painted International Orange. Other similarities include a [[Tollbooths|toll plaza]] on the San Fierro side, and a large steel latticework structure supported by concrete and built over [[Jizzy's Pleasure Domes|an old fort]] at [[Battery Point]] and into the hillside, providing the anchorage on the San Fierro side.

Other than the similarity to the Golden Gate Bridge, the Gant Bridge is not a particularly necessary roadway in the city, given the presence of the [[Garver Bridge]] to the east. The small freeway that comes of the bridge in San Fierro ends unexpectedly on a relatively minor road in [[Downtown San Fierro]], instead of connecting with something more major.
